Product Overview

AD8479-EP is a difference amplifier with a very high input common-mode voltage (VCM) range. It is a precision device that allows the user to accurately measure differential signals in the presence of high VCM upto ±600V dc. It can replace costly isolation amplifiers in applications that do not require galvanic isolation. The device operates over a ±600V dc VCM range and has inputs that are protected from common-mode or differential mode transients upto ±600V. It has low offset voltage, low offset voltage drift, low gain drift, low common-mode rejection drift, and excellent common-mode rejection ratio (CMRR) over a wide frequency range. It is used in applications such as avionics, unmanned systems, high voltage current sensing, motor controls, isolation.
  • Rail-to-rail output, fixed gain of 1
  • Wide power supply operating voltage range from ±2.5V to ±18V
  • Supply current is 550μA typical at (VOUT = 0V, TA = 25°C)
  • Common-mode rejection ratio is 90dB typical at (TA = 25°C)
  • Small signal -3dB bandwidth is 130KHz typical at (TA = 25°C)
  • Gain nonlinearity is 10ppm typical at (TA = 25°C)
  • Offset voltage drift is 15µV/°C maximum at (TA = TMIN to TMAX, TA = 25°C)
  • Gain drift is 5ppm/°C typical at (TA = TMIN to TMAX, TA = 25°C)
  • Slew rate is 9V/µs typ at (TA = 25°C), noise spectral density is 1.6μV/√Hz typ
  • Operating temperature is -55°C to +125°C, package style is 8-lead SOIC-N
